Variant summary
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1
The NM_032131.6(ARMC2):c.2153-194A>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.19 in 152,116 control chromosomes in the GnomAD database, including 3,314 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
ARMC2 (HGNC:23045): (armadillo repeat containing 2) Involved in sperm axoneme assembly. Implicated in spermatogenic failure 38. [provided by Alliance of Genome Resources, Apr 2022]
ARMC2 Gene-Disease associations (from GenCC):
- spermatogenic failure 38Inheritance: AR Classification: DEFINITIVE, STRONG Submitted by: ClinGen, Labcorp Genetics (formerly Invitae)
- non-syndromic male infertility due to sperm motility disorderInheritance: AR Classification: SUPPORTIVE Submitted by: Orphanet
